Our 9th #BuildCommunityPower Conference took place Thursday, April 11, 2019 at the Grand Hyatt New York.
ANHD’s annual #BuildCommunityPower policy conference is the event for New York City’s community groups, mission-driven developers, neighborhood organizers, banks and bank regulators, foundation funders, and government decision makers interested in affordable housing and equitable economic development. Our full-day conference features:
- High-profile plenary speakers
- Advocates and experts from across the field
- Timely policy and skills-development sessions
- Networking opportunities to discuss pressing community development issues

John C. Williams became the 11th president and chief executive officer of the New York Fed on June 18th of 2018. In that capacity, he serves as the vice chairman and a permanent member of the Federal Open Market Committee (FOMC).

Trickle-Down Development: Why Do City Leaders Say that Unrestricted Development Helps Low-Wealth Neighborhoods?
New market-rate housing is said to add to the general housing supply, which relieves demand and causes some higher-cost housing to “filter down” to become low-cost housing. Economic development deals such as Amazon are said to be worth it because, while most of the jobs will be for high-end professionals, in the end the benefits will trickle down to a wider range of people. Are these arguments true?
